I would rather not have to use this mode at all but my previous workflow does not work in Resolve 20. My previous workflow was like this:
- 1. Open a timeline in the timeline monitor.
- 2. Open a timeline in the source monitor.
- 3. Make a selection in the timeline monitor.
- 4. hit alt-h which is macro that performed three functions:
- 1. swapped source and timeline
- 2. Insert and of timeline
- 3. swapped source and timeline.
This is a very simple workflow. I made a selection, hit Alt-h, and waited half a second for it to paste to the end of the other timeline. Then repeat. All of this I did in single viewer mode because I'm on a laptop.
Release 20 seems to have removed 'swap source and timeline', so I can no longer use this method. I therefore tried to duplicate it with the new "Open Timeline with Source Viewer". But that seems to work only in dual-screen mode.
This is a real problem for me and probably enough to go back to R19. The simplest fix would be to reinstate 'swap source and timeline'. Another fix would be to not exit "Open Timeline with Source Viewer" mode when switching to single viewer mode.
